Community-acquired pneumonia

CURB-65 score can help assess severity.

Score 1 point for each of:

  • New confusion (AMT ≤ 8)
  • Urea > 7 mmol / L
  • Resp rate ≥ 30 / minute
  • BP (diastolic ≤ 60 mmHg or systolic < 90 mmHg)
  • Age ≥ 65

Treatment regimens are suitable for use in patients with or without suspected or known COVID-19 infection

Treat only if there is clinical suspicion of bacterial infection, such as purulent sputum, or evidence of consolidation

CURB 65 = 0-1

ORAL

DOXYCYCLINE 200mg stat, then 100mg OD

Or

AMOXICILLIN 1g TDS

INTRAVENOUS

AMOXICILLIN 1g TDS

Duration 5 days

CURB 65 = 2

ORAL

AMOXICILLIN 1g TDS

Plus

DOXYCYCLINE 200mg stat, then 100mg OD

True penicillin allergy:

DOXYCYCLINE (monotherapy) 200mg stat, then 100mg OD

INTRAVENOUS - Seek medical advice

AMOXICILLIN 1g TDS

Plus

DOXYCYCLINE (PO) 200mg stat, then 100mg OD

True penicillin allergy:

COTRIMOXAZOLE 960mg BD (eGFR >35)

True penicillin allergy AND eGFR is <35

LEVOFLOXACIN (refer to SPC for dosing in renal impairment)

Duration: 5 days

CURB 65 = 3 or greater

No suitable initial oral treatment

Seek medical advice

INTRAVENOUS

CO-AMOXICLAV 1.2g TDS

Plus

DOXYCYCLINE 200mg stat, then 100mg OD

True penicillin allergy:

COTRIMOXAZOLE 960mg BD (eGFR >35)

True penicillin allergy AND eGFR is <35

LEVOFLOXACIN (refer to SPC for dosing in renal impairment)

Duration: 5 days

Exacerbation of COPD with clinical evidence of bacterial infection

ORAL

DOXYCYCLINE 200mg stat, then 100mg OD

Or

AMOXICILLIN 1g TDS

If clinical failure of oral therapy, send sputum and consider CO-AMOXICLAV 625mg TDS PO / 1.2g TDS IV

INTRAVENOUS

AMOXICILLIN 1g TDS

Duration 5 days

Aspiration Pneumonia

ORAL

CO-AMOXICLAV 625mg TDS

True penicillin allergy:

Discuss with Microbiology

INTRAVENOUS

CO-AMOXICLAV 1.2g TDS

True penicillin allergy:

Discuss with Microbiology

Duration: 5-7 days

Hospital or Nursing Home acquired Pneumonia

ORAL

DOXYCYCLINE 200mg stat, then 100mg OD

Or

COTRIMOXAZOLE 960mg BD (eGFR >35)

INTRAVENOUS

AMOXICILLIN 1g TDS

Plus

GENTAMICIN

Dose as per calculator

If IV treatment is still needed after three days, convert GENTAMICIN to:

TEMOCILLIN 2g TDS

True penicillin allergy:

Discuss with Microbiology

Duration 5-7 days
